1章WordPressの概要

1章では、まず、WordPressとは何か、また、本書の目的と対象者について説明します。次いで、WordPressをインストールした際に、同時にインストールされるサンプル投稿の「Hello world!」ページへのブラウザでのアクセスを例に、WordPressの動作原理の一端をHTTPリクエストとHTTPレスポンスをそれぞれWordPressへのインプットとアウトプットと捉えてその基本的な仕組みを説明します。

1.1 本書の目的

本書の目的は日頃WordPressを利用してWebサイトやWebシステムを制作、開発している読者のみなさんに、WordPressの本質的な仕組みを提示し、原理・原則に沿ったWebサイト構築を実現できる実力形成の一助となることにあります。

WordPressは世界中のWebサイトのおよそ22%以上で利用されているパブリッシングプラットフォームです。「パブリッシングの民主化」という思想のもと、世界各地のボランティアによってオープンソースのGPLライセンスの下に開発されているPHP、MySQLベースのソフトウェアです。

WordPressはもともとブログソフトウェアとして開発されていましたが、現在では、ブログのみならず、多くの企業や団体のCMSとして、Webアプリケーションのプラットフォームとしても利用されています。むしろ、WordPressでの制作、開発を行っている開発者の多くは、CMSまたはWebアプリケーションのプラットフォームとしてWordPressを利用しているというのが実際のところでしょう。

WordPressの圧倒的なシェアの背景は、どこにあるのでしょうか。

パブリッシングの民主化という思想、「5分インストール」に代表される利用、開発の圧倒的な敷居の低さ、美しくユーザビリティの高い管理画面、Web標準に準拠したソースコード、バージョンアップの際の徹底した後方互換の確保、公式ディレクトリに登録されているものだけで3万以上あるプラグインによる容易な機能拡張、同じく公式ディレクトリに登録されているものだけで2千以上あるテーマによる容易なWebサイトの外観の変更などいくつもの理由があります。 ...

Get 詳解 WordPress now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.